Welcome Guest [Log In] [Register]

North America

Regular Forum (No New Posts) Cain Station
The biggest Station from Earth to Space, Shuttles come and go constantly it’s protected by a constant watch; the military forces use all types of Mobile Suits to make sure that it all works efficiently whit out any type of problem.
No Posts in Forum
Topics: 0 Replies: 0